Insurance Renewal — Managers' Wiki

Heads up: the group policy with Ashgrove Mutual renews end of June. Premiums are up a bit, cover is broadly the same, and the claims process moves fully online. Flag any new equipment to Priya in facilities before the cut-off. The reason we're renewing early is noted below.

board note of kageg-bahof: The renewal with Holwynax Holdings closes at $2 million a year, 5 percent below the last contract. Project Ulaath slips by two quarters because of the supplier delay.

## Runbook: Hunting Leaked File Descriptors in Grainloft

Quick recap for the sync: Grainloft workers keep creeping toward the descriptor ceiling after ~36 hours, then fall over with "too many open files." Prime suspect is the archive streamer not closing handles on partial reads. To chase it: snapshot open descriptors per worker, diff against the previous hour, and flag anything growing monotonically. Don't just raise the ulimit and walk away — that buys time, not a fix. For reference, the service currently runs with these limits and timeouts.

config for bagep-kageg:
ULADOR_LOG_LEVEL=warn
ULADOR_METRICS_HOST=metrics.ulador.tolvaqcorp.corp
ULADOR_POOL_SIZE=32

**Ticket: Tracewire span store connection failures**

Since the 4.2 release, the Tracewire collector intermittently fails to persist spans, causing gaps in cross-service request traces. Errors indicate refused connections during peak ingest, roughly every 20 minutes. Impact is observability only; no customer traffic is affected, but the release manager should hold the rollout until resolved. To reproduce against staging, connect to the span store with the string below.

replica DSN, kajep-yahag: mssql://praok_svc:iF@db-8d68.plorvaio.local:5432/eliion

For the incoming director: the renegotiation with Pellam Estates concluded last month. Headline rent falls 8% against the prior term, offset partly by a longer ten-year commitment with a five-year break clause. Fit-out contributions of approximately 220k were secured, to be drawn down against approved works. Service charges remain capped at indexation plus one point. Maurel Finch's team modelled three exit scenarios, all within tolerance. The strategic considerations informing these terms appear in the confidential note below.

management briefing: Quenionax Partners is in early talks to buy Rusionax Partners for about $22.5 million. The Briiel launch date is February 27, and nothing goes to the press before then.